Output 3dd38ae64daca89369cc1ce8539b94065cfdfb2aa73577c1728ad978e805df69:9

value
73107419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ff705d588ccfc3d0064647f5730d0f7fdfe9e0e1 OP_EQUAL
address
3Qyeqh6HB9kpF3VSS1W3zqZqHcieU1kdzE
transaction
3dd38ae64daca89369cc1ce8539b94065cfdfb2aa73577c1728ad978e805df69
spent
true